Full description for The Craving Brain
Where do the roots of addictive behavior lie -- in our genes or in our environment, in our chemistry or in our character? "In the Craving Brain," Dr. Ronald Ruden asserts that the roots of addiction most defintetly do not lie in our character. Rather, they lie in a complex chain reaction that originates in an ancient survival mechanism in the brain. When this system is inappropriately activated, it drives the body to crave, sometimes with addictive behavior as the end result.
